Transaction 243980e3527664f83b5be73c107dede09240aefbc61300317603925c50545546
1 Input
1 Output
-
243980e3527664f83b5be73c107dede09240aefbc61300317603925c50545546:0
- value
- 1157199
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bb7f2616ac8f825c75463da2a7fb516682c5d25b OP_EQUAL
- address
- 3JnQbsKYHKvR3ukWynHwFbQ89zbutxbqEj